CBD takes time to show its full effects

When starting a CBD routine, it’s important to remember that CBD takes time to show its full effects in our bodies.  

 

We often see signs of CBD start working in the first 2-3 weeks of daily usage.  While that can seem like some time, it’s important to understand that CBD compounds over time and to give your body the space it needs to adjust. It takes time because CBD works with our body’s Endocannabinoid System (or ECS for short). Our ECS is an “umbrella system” that is responsible for managing every other system in our body…everything from our digestion to our menstrual cycle, to our wake-and-sleep cycle is managed by this larger system, the Endocannabinoid System!

CBD absorption 

The WAY you take your CBD matters! The more CBD your body absorbs, the more bioavailable it is, which means your body can then utilize it for supporting your Endocannabinoid System. You can try these tips and tricks for better absorption: 

 

  • Daily Drops: Put the Drops under your tongue and try to hold them there for at least 60 seconds.  The CBD sinks in through the glands under your tongue, so to absorb it fully as possible, we suggest setting a 60-second timer and hold the Drops under your tongue for that full minute or even a bit longer!.  
  • Daily Softgels: Try taking your Softgels alongside a meal or a snack, especially foods that are rich in healthy fats.  According to a University of Minnesota study, eating a fat-rich meal with your CBD can allow it to absorb up to 4x more! 
  • Daily Gummies: Be sure to chew your gummy thoroughly!  The more you chew the Daily Gummy, the more that the CBD starts to break down in your mouth and begins absorbing right away through your sublingual glands.  Then whatever is swallowed will kick in about 30 minutes later, once it’s gone through your digestive system.

Your dose

Many folks think that CBD dosing is just based on your height and weight…but your CBD dose has a lot more to do with the amount of stress you’ve experienced in your lifetime and your full wellness profile! One of CBD’s roles is to help combat the negative effects of stress hormones like cortisol, adrenaline, and norepinephrine.  When our body is constantly stressed and living in a heightened “fight or flight” mode, cortisol can skyrocket and cause our body’s endocannabinoids to become depleted.  

 

While we always suggest starting off “low and slow” with your CBD routine, we often find that folks who have a history of ongoing issues may need stronger doses.  More severe issues like lasting discomfort, autoimmune disorders, or a lifetime of depression or anxiety can contribute to our Endocannabinoid System to be depleted.  It’s understandable for these more severe issues to take a bit more time and stronger doses to improve.  A daily, consistent routine is key!
